In the glass
Aroma: red cherry, spice, rose, earth
Palate: raspberry, mineral, sweet spice, silk
Classic Vosne perfume at the village level: red cherry, spice and a silky, accessible palate.

History
A blend of village Vosne parcels, often the entry point to the domaine's style.
- 1985 — Estate bottling began
